Nearly half a million people signed up on Healthcare.gov in first week

The administration is reporting that 462,125 people selected health insurance plans on the federal exchange, Healthcare.gov, in the first week of open enrollment. Nearly half—48 percent—were new customers, buying plans for the first time. That's good news, indicating that outreach to the uninsured is working and there could be another significant reduction in the uninsured rate after this round. The new numbers, released by Health and Human Services Wednesday, show a faster start to open enrollment this year than in 2013.
